Anthony Baffoe To Be Crowned Sports Personality of the Year At 42nd MTN-SWAG Awards

The 42nd edition of the most cherished sports award ceremony in Africa [MTN-SWAG Awards Night] beckons this Saturday, May 27, 2017 in Accra as the Sports Writers Association of Ghana will be rewarding deserving sportsmen and women for their contribution towards national development in the area of sports.

As the spirit behind the award postulate, over twenty-five awards will be conferred on deserving sports personalities in different categories come Saturday at the Banquet Hall, State House in Accra.

But, before the ish! and aww! On Saturday, www.sports24ghana.com can predict that former Black Stars defender and the founder of the Professional Footballers Association of Ghana, Anthony Baffoe is going to win the most prestigious award on the night – The Sports Personality of the Year.

The Sports Personality of the Year category is a straight battle between Emmanuel ‘The Game Boy’ Tagoe and former Black Stars defender and now FIFA and CAF venue coordinator, Anthony Baffoe.

Still undefeated, Emmanuel Tagoe opened the newly built Bukom Boxing Arena with a unanimous decision [120-106], [120-106], [120-106] victory over South African Mzonke Fana to clinch the IBO lightweight world title.

With a paltry 16 caps for the senior national team of Ghana, Anthony Baffoe retired from international football after the Tunisia 1994 African Cup of Nations.

He has occupied and played various roles for both the Federation of International Football Association [FIFA] as well as the Confederation of African Football [CAF].

Mr. Baffoe also founded the Professional Footballers Association of Ghana which is the local wing of the FIFPro.

Again, Anthony Baffoe is a FIFA Ambassador for campaign against racism and he exhibited it recently when Sulley Muntari was racially abused during a Serie A match involving Pescara and Cagliari.

Despite Game Boy’s prowess in the year under discussion, the crown at stake here befits Anthony Baffoe more than the Game Boy.
